FAAC Gate Repair β€” What You Need to Know

FAAC automatic gate operators, particularly their robust hydraulic models like the FAAC 400 or 422, demand a sophisticated understanding of fluid dynamics and pressure systems. Common vulnerabilities include seals degrading over time, often exacerbated by West Chicago's wide temperature swings, leading to hydraulic fluid leaks. Issues with the internal pump and motor, vital for piston operation, are also prevalent. Our technicians are expertly trained to meticulously disassemble, repair, and reassemble these complex hydraulic components, ensuring precise calibration.

Electrical system failures frequently affect FAAC operators, ranging from malfunctioning control boards (such as E045 or E124 units) to issues with safety photocells or induction loop detectors. Diagnosing these requires advanced electrical troubleshooting skills, essential for tracing faults in wiring, verifying component integrity, and ensuring correct signal transmission, especially after power surges or nearby lightning strikes common in Illinois summers. We maintain an extensive inventory of genuine FAAC electrical components for rapid and effective replacements.

For electromechanical FAAC models, including the S450H or 412, mechanical wear on gearboxes, motor brushes, or limit switches can precipitate operational failures. These necessitate careful inspection of the drive mechanism and often require precise component replacement. West Chicago's distinct climate, characterized by brutal, snowy winters and hot, often humid summers, presents unique challenges for FAAC gate operators. Hydraulic systems are particularly vulnerable to these extreme temperature fluctuations; frigid temperatures can thicken hydraulic fluid, placing immense strain on the pump and motor, while summer heat can stress electrical components and cause seals to degrade more rapidly. Regular inspection and timely driveway gate repair in West Chicago are paramount to mitigate these climate-induced issues before they escalate.

The persistent freeze-thaw cycles prevalent in the West Chicago area, especially impacting properties in neighborhoods like Wegman Woods, Foxfield, or near Reed-Keppler Park, can cause ground shifting. This movement directly affects gate alignment and the stability of operator mounts, leading to increased structural stress and premature wear on critical FAAC components. Common FAAC Gate Repair Problems in West Chicago

πŸ”§ Hydraulic Fluid Leaks

FAAC's advanced hydraulic operators can develop leaks from seals or connections due to age, intense usage, or the drastic temperature fluctuations common in West Chicago. This compromises power, causes erratic movement, or leads to total failure, necessitating specialized repair of the hydraulic circuit.

πŸ”§ Control Board Malfunctions

The sophisticated FAAC control boards (e.g., E045 or E124) are susceptible to failure from power surges, moisture intrusion (especially in humid summers), or internal component degradation. This can result in unresponsive remotes, incorrect gate sequencing, or a completely dead system, requiring expert diagnostics and replacement.

πŸ”§ Motor Overheating or Stalling

FAAC motors can overheat or stall if there's excessive friction from misaligned gates (due to ground shift), a failing capacitor, or internal motor winding issues. This often points to a deeper problem within the drive unit or the gate's physical hardware, requiring professional assessment to prevent further damage.

πŸ”§ Safety Device Failure

FAAC gates rely on crucial safety photocells and induction loop detectors. If these sensors are misaligned (perhaps from landscaping changes), damaged by snowplows, or experience wiring faults, the gate may refuse to close or operate erratically. Diagnosing these issues requires precise beam alignment and electrical continuity checks.

πŸ”§ Actuator Arm Issues

For FAAC swing gates, problems with the actuator arm itselfβ€”such as bent components, worn pivots, or internal piston damageβ€”can prevent smooth operation. This typically results in grinding noises, jerky movements, or the gate becoming stuck mid-cycle, often exacerbated by physical impacts or prolonged stress from a misaligned gate.

Maintenance Tips for West Chicago Properties

πŸ› οΈ Regular Visual Inspection
Periodically check your FAAC gate and operator for any visible signs of wear, hydraulic leaks, or loose connections. Early detection of issues like hydraulic drips or frayed wiring can prevent major breakdowns, especially after harsh West Chicago winters.
πŸ› οΈ Keep Area Clear
Ensure the path of your gate and the area around the operator are free from debris, overgrown vegetation, or, critically, snow and ice during winter months. Obstructions can strain the FAAC motor and cause damage to the operator arm or sliding mechanism.
πŸ› οΈ Test Safety Features
Regularly test your FAAC gate's safety photocells and auto-reverse functions. Place an object (like a cardboard box) in the gate's path to confirm it stops or reverses as intended, ensuring the safety of people and vehicles in busy West Chicago areas like near Community High School District 94.

FAAC Gate Repair FAQ β€” West Chicago, IL

My FAAC gate is making grinding noises. What could be the cause?+
Grinding noises from a FAAC gate often indicate issues with the operator's internal gears, bearings, or the hinge points of the gate itself. For hydraulic systems, it could point to a failing pump or low fluid levels. It's crucial to have a professional inspect it promptly, as continued operation can lead to more severe damage to the costly FAAC operator components or the gate structure.
Why won't my FAAC gate close completely?+
If your FAAC gate won't close completely, it could be due to several reasons. Common culprits include misaligned safety photocells, faulty limit switches not signaling the 'closed' position, or obstructions in the gate's path. Sometimes, a control board error or an issue with the motor's torque settings can also prevent full closure. A technician can accurately diagnose the precise issue.
How long do FAAC gate operators typically last?+
FAAC gate operators are known for their longevity, often lasting 10-15 years or more with proper installation and regular maintenance. Factors like usage frequency, environmental conditions, and adherence to maintenance schedules significantly impact their lifespan. Neglecting routine service can drastically shorten the life of even the most durable FAAC system.
Can I repair my FAAC gate myself?+
While minor troubleshooting like remote battery replacement might be feasible, repairing complex FAAC hydraulic or electrical systems is strongly discouraged for untrained individuals. These systems involve high voltage, intricate mechanics, and precise calibration. Attempting DIY repairs can be dangerous, void warranties, and often lead to further, more costly damage. Always rely on certified FAAC professionals.
What's the difference between hydraulic and electromechanical FAAC operators?+
FAAC hydraulic operators (like the 400 series) use fluid pressure to move the gate, offering exceptional power, quiet operation, and durability for heavy or high-cycle gates. Electromechanical operators (like the 412) use a motor and gearbox, are generally simpler, and are well-suited for lighter, lower-cycle gates. Each type has specific repair and maintenance requirements based on its distinct operating mechanism.
